Pep Guardiola admitted sleepless nights as Manchester City’s struggles deepened with a stunning late collapse in the Manchester derby. Despite Josko Gvardiol’s first-half header giving City the lead, a late Manchester United resurgence turned the game on its head. Matheus Nunes’ error led to Bruno Fernandes converting an 88th-minute penalty, before Amad Diallo capitalized on defensive chaos to seal United’s victory two minutes later. Guardiola, visibly agitated throughout, criticized himself post-match, saying, “I am not good enough. I have to find solutions.” The loss marked a rare City defeat after leading at halftime, raising questions about their fading dominance.
